Write the symbols and valencies of the following radicals:
- Magnesium ion
- Ammonium
- Carbonate
- Nitrate
- Oxide
- Bisulphate
- Aluminium ion
Advertisements
उत्तर
| Elements | Symbols | Valencies | |
| (a) | Magnesium ion | `"Mg"^(2+)` | 2 |
| (b) | Amonium | `"NH"_4^+` | 1 |
| (c) | carbonate | `"CO"_3^-2` | 2 |
| (d) | Nitrate | `"NO"_3^-` | 1 |
| (e) | Oxide | `"O"^(2-)` | 2 |
| (f) | Bisulphate | `"HOS"_4^-` | 1 |
| (g) | Aluminium ion | `"AI"^(3+)` |
3 |
